1. What is the difference between garden mix and topsoil?
Garden mix and topsoil serve different jobs. Topsoil is mainly used to fill and level garden beds or replace poor existing soil, while a richer blend like our Premium Organic Garden Mix adds compost, aged manure and mulch to actively feed plants and improve soil structure. If you're planting straight into the ground, garden mix gives your plants a stronger start than plain topsoil alone.
2. How much soil do I need for my garden or lawn?
Measure the length and width of the area in metres and multiply by the depth you want to add, in metres, to get the volume in cubic metres. For example, a 10 square metre garden bed topped up 100mm deep needs 1 cubic metre of soil. 4. What is underlay soil and do I need it before laying turf?
Underlay soil is a base layer placed before laying new turf to support root establishment and drainage. Our Organic Turf Grow Underlay is a fertilised 50/50 blend of soil, ash and sand for strong root growth, while our budget 80/20 underlay, 80% sand and 20% organic soil, suits most standard lawns. Getting the underlay right makes a big difference to how well new turf takes and stays green.

8. What is the best soil for potted plants?
Our Premium Potting Mix, a blend of Premium Garden Mix and composted pine, is the best choice for pots, planters and raised containers. It stays free draining while holding enough nutrients and moisture for healthy root growth, unlike heavier garden soils which can compact and waterlog in a pot.
